5. What to Look for in a 2026 Water Softener
When choosing a system — whether it’s WaterCare, AO Smith, EcoWater, or Brita Pro — here are the must-have features to ensure strong performance and long-term satisfaction:
Smart Regeneration Controls
Softening systems that regenerate based on actual water use instead of a fixed schedule will use less salt and water, saving you money and reducing waste.
High-Efficiency Resin Media
This is the heart of softening — good resin media removes hardness minerals effectively and lasts longer between service intervals.
Proper System Sizing
A softener that’s too small will regenerate too often, and one that’s too large wastes resources. Always size based on household usage and water hardness levels.
Professional Testing and Installation
Even the best softener underperforms if it’s not correctly matched to your water quality. A professional water test helps determine hardness, iron content, pH, and other factors before choosing a system.
